It doesn’t look like the war between reality TV star Jon Gosselin and the TLC network, is going to end for a while yet. According to people.com, Jon has recently filed a $5 million lawsuit against the network that aired his reality show.
Jon is now claiming that the network’s representatives damaged his reputation and his career, by preventing him from working with other media outlets. He says that they contacted several media outlets, to persuade them not to deal with him.

The father of eight’s attorney Mark Heller has said that TLC’s behavior has caused Jon great anguish and financial loss. Mark also says that Jon did not have a manager or attorney there when he signed his contract for “Jon & Kate Plus 8.”
Gosselin’s lawsuit against TLC, which is a counterclaim for the one they have filed against him, also claims that the network breached its own contract with him and now owes Jon $175,000, for shows that have already been aired.
